מה זה פולימורפיזם?

פולימורפיזם הוא מונח כללי שפירושו 'צורות רבות'. דוגמה פופולרית לכך היא Odo ממסע בין כוכבים: Deep Space Nine. הוא היה משתנה, יצור שיכול לשנות את צורתו בכל עת לפי הצורך כדי שכל מצב ישרוד. ShapeShifter מגן על אתר אינטרנט על ידי שינוי קוד ה-HTML, Javascript או CSS שלו, כך שבמקום אלמנטים סטטיים וקבועים לתוקפים לתכנת התקפה נגדם, הם עומדים בפני "יעד נע, המשכתב את עצמו כל הזמן". משתמשים לגיטימיים ממשיכים לראות את ממשק המשתמש ללא שינוי.

בתחום אבטחת האינטרנט פולימורפיזם הוא אמצעי סטנדרטי לביצוע תוכנות זדוניות. הוא ידוע בכך שהוא מקל על קבצים וכלים לא רצויים ונגועים העיוורים לתוכנות ואפליקציות אנטי-וירוס. המרקחות הזדוניות הן

בתחום התכנות מונחה האובייקטים, פולימורפיזם הוא המקום שבו תת-מחלקה גוברת על שיטה ממעמד בסיסי. השיטה של ​​מחלקה יכולה להראות התנהגויות שונות בתתי מחלקות. תחשוב על הדרך הזו. מתכנת מקים כיתת "שירה". ה"שירה" יכולה להשתמש בשיטה הנקראת "שיר", ותתי המחלקות "סלאם" ו"גזאל" יכולות לאפשר ל"שיר" השיטה להשמיע צלילים שונים מרגע אחד למשנהו. תכונה זו משמשת לפעמים למשהו כמו פריצה או משחקי מחשב.

פולימורפיזם יכול לשמש את החבר'ה הטובים והרעים, וכמובן, ההגדרה של "רע" ו"טוב" תלויה במוחו של המתבונן. פולימורפיזם הוא תוכנה זדונית. תוכנה זדונית היא תוכנה זדונית שאחת מהן משמשת כדי לשבש את פעולתו של מכשיר אחד נוסף ברשת. הם שואפים, שניים, לגנוב מידע רגיש או, שלוש, להשיג גישה לא חוקית למערכות מכשירים פרטיים. תוכנה זדונית משתמשת בתוכן פעיל (תוכן שהוא אינטראקטיבי או דינמי כמו חידונים מרובים וסקרי אינטרנט), קוד וסקריפטים כדי לעשות את שלושת הדברים האלה.

תוכנה זדונית שעוברת מוטציה אוטומטית היא פולימורפית. בגלל היכולת של אודו של מסע בין כוכבים לשנות את המראה שלו בכל עת, הוא שימש לעתים קרובות כבלש כדי לשרש פעילות לא חוקית. הוא התאים בצורה מושלמת לתפקיד בדיוק כפי שפולימורפיזם בתוכנות זדוניות מקשה מאוד על צוות IT של חברה למצוא ולהרוס. במילים אחרות, בדיוק כמו בחיינו הפיזיים, חיינו הווירטואליים מתמודדים עם דברים שאינם כפי שהם נראים.

כמו "הדבר" של ג'ון וו. קמפבל, תוכנות זדוניות שהן פולימורפיות, שיכולות "לשנות צורה", יכולות לספוג למעשה את הזיכרונות של כל יצור (או מכשיר) שהיא משתלטת עליה. מכיוון שהתוכנה הזדונית יכולה לשנות את המראה בכל עת, קשה לעקוב אחריה, אך היא גם יכולה לאסוף יותר "ידע" על המטרות שלה. שימו לב שב"החרב והאבן", מרלין הפך את ארתור לבעלי חיים שונים ב"החרב באבן", גם למטרות חינוכיות. זה יכול להסתובב זמן רב יותר מכיוון שלא ניתן לזהות אותו בקלות, אבל גם להמשיך הלאה באמצעות כתובות URL נגועות, הודעות SMS וכלי תחבורה אחרים ברשת. זה לא סטטי אלא דינאמי.

פולימורפיזם הוא כלי הן עבור תוכנות זדוניות והן עבור כנופיות ומאפיות ברחבי העולם, כמו גם נגד תוכנות זדוניות או הגנת DDoS נציגים להשתתף במה שאפשר לכנות "מרדף קסום" כמו זה של האגדות הפופולריות שני קוסמים או איכר ווטרסקי. הנרדף תמיד משנה צורות כדי לאבד את הרודף. לרודף בסיפור ולרודף שצוד את התוכנה הזדונית המשמרת צורה… יש פוטנציאל לשנות צורה. בשנת 2014, מכיוון שלאוניברסיטאות ומכוני פולי טכניים רבים יש תוכניות מחקר המחפשות שיטות יעילות יותר להבטחת אבטחת האינטרנט, פולימורפיזם יהיה נושא חם ב-2014.



Source by Lisa Alfrejd

You may also like...

כתיבת תגובה

האימייל לא יוצג באתר. שדות החובה מסומנים *